Manuscript Categories
Original Research Articles
Full-length manuscripts presenting novel findings from clinical studies, laboratory research, or translational investigations. Research articles should provide comprehensive methodological detail, appropriate statistical analysis, and clear clinical or scientific implications. Typical research articles range from 4,000 to 8,000 words.
Review Articles
Comprehensive reviews synthesizing current knowledge on significant topics in spine and neuroscience. Systematic reviews and meta-analyses are particularly welcome. Reviews should provide critical analysis rather than simple literature surveys. Prospective review authors are encouraged to contact the editorial office with a brief proposal before full submission.
Case Reports
Clinical case presentations highlighting unusual presentations, diagnostic challenges, innovative treatments, or educational value. Case reports should include appropriate patient consent documentation and follow CARE guidelines. Limited to 3,000 words with maximum 6 figures.
Technical Notes
Brief reports on surgical techniques, procedural innovations, or methodological advances. Technical notes should include sufficient detail for reproducibility and clear outcome assessment.

Submission Guidelines
Prepare your manuscript according to JSN author guidelines. Original research should follow IMRAD structure with structured abstracts. Clinical studies should report according to CONSORT, STROBE, or PRISMA guidelines as appropriate. Ensure figures are high resolution and properly de-identified.
